Reducing residential and industrial electricity consumption has been a goal of governments around the world. Lighting sources account for a large portion of the whole energy/power consumption. Unfortunately, most of the existing installed lighting systems are ancient and have poor energy efficiency. Today, many manufacturers have introduced light-controlling systems into the current market. However, existing light controlling systems may not be successfully applied to buildings, streets, and industrial buildings due to high costs and difficult installation and maintenance. To combat this issue, this article presents an easy-to-install, low-cost, Master-Slave intelligent LED light-controlling system based on Internet of Things (IoT) techniques. The benefit of using the proposed system is that the brightness of the LED lights in the same zone can be changed simultaneously to save in energy consumption. Furthermore, the parameters of the LED lights can be directly set. Moreover, the related data are collected and uploaded to a cloud platform. In this article, we use 15 W T8 LED tubes (non-induction lamps) as a case study. When the proposed system is installed in a zone with few people, the energy-saving rate is as high as 90%. Furthermore, when 12 people pass by a zone within one hour, its energy-saving rate can reach 81%. Therefore, the advantages of using the proposed system include: (1) the original lamp holder can be retained; (2) no wiring is required; and (3) no server is set up. Moreover, the goal of energy saving can also be achieved. As a result, the proposed system changes the full-dark mode of the available sensor lamp to the low power low-light mode for standby. Further, it makes the sensor lamps in the same zone brighten or low-light way simultaneously, which can quickly complete large-scale energy-saving and convenient control functions of intelligent LED lighting controlling system.

Abstract An intelligent lifestyle has become a hotspot for researchers and industries nowadays. The smart home monitoring and controlling system with the Arduino as the main controller is designed in this paper, combined with sensors, Wi-Fi, and cloud technologies. Various sensors collect household environmental information, such as indoor temperature and humidity, soil moisture, combustible gas concentration, and light intensity. The main controller processes the collected signals and automatically operates the devices, including a refrigeration equipment, water pump, buzzer, fan, stepping motor. The data can also be transmitted to the cloud platform through Wi-Fi for processing, and the home environment information and device can be remotely monitored and controlled by the cloud platform or smartphone APP.

The paper presents the analysis and determines factors effecting the budget program implementation, which leads to decrease the efficiency and effectiveness for budget outcomes provided to public. The importance of a municipality budget program is related to the standards of population living, thus obstructing the implementation of programs cause a direct negative impact upon people’s life. Municipalities seek to optimize the use of resources and allocate them to the planned programs in order to obtain the best results in terms of quantity. Distribution of financial allocations to the planned projects is one of the most important steps in preparing the budget. A negative impact of some factors on the budget programs implementation is proved. There was used a questionnaire to investigate the managers and employees from the related department as accountants, administrators, engineers, and auditors in municipalities of the middle Euphrates of Iraq. Basically, there were interviewed the department managers to design factors affecting the implementation of budget programs and preparing questioners for their employees. There was suggested the hypothesis for the research and determined the factors influencing budget programs trajectories rather than quality or quantity. Among the most important recommendations are emphasized the protection of municipal departments from political parties’ interference, increasing coordination between the municipal departments and the central and local governments, and rehabilitating the controlling system.

concepts, principles and functions of the formation and development of controlling are characterized. The necessity of the organization of financial controlling in the enterprise is grounded, the main stages of the introduction of controlling in the formation of the financial strategy of the enterprise in modern conditions are proposed. It is proved that the difference in the principles of organization of enterprise finance determines the need for differentiation of controlling objects for business entities operating on the basis of commercial calculation, non-profitable activity and estimated financing. If for commercial calculation it is the profit and market value of the enterprise, for non-profitable enterprises it is cash flows that must be efficiently generated and redistributed in accordance with their intended purpose; for enterprises operating on the principles of budget or budget financing, the level of income coverage. The effectiveness of the controlling system is determined by the efficiency of enterprise management. It is proved that the financial strategy is the basis of enterprise management and its production and economic, financial activities in a modern dynamic and competitive environment. The basic principles are investigated at the stages of the implementation of the financial strategy, which allow to correct its directions, which lead enterprises to sustainable development.
